Who might be able to join this trial:
- You are 18 years of age or older, regardless of gender.
- You are willing and able to follow the study schedule and requirements.
- You have been formally diagnosed with multiple myeloma according to established diagnostic guidelines, and your disease can be measured through specific blood or urine tests showing certain protein levels above defined thresholds (confirm with trial site).
- You have already received at least 3 previous rounds of treatment, which must have included three specific types of therapy: a proteasome inhibitor, an immunomodulatory drug, and an anti-CD38 antibody treatment (confirm with trial site for exact drug names).
Who may not be able to join:
- You have a known allergy or sensitivity to any ingredient in the treatment being studied.
- You have been diagnosed with an active form of blood cancer called plasma cell leukemia, or a condition called systemic light chain amyloidosis (confirm with trial site).
- You have an active serious mental health condition, serious physical health condition, or other symptoms that could affect your treatment or your ability to give informed consent, as judged by the study doctor.
- Your disease has already been treated with two specific drugs — pomalidomide and selinexor — and did not respond to them (confirm with trial site).
